Avoiding Sewer Backups And Operational Disasters

Imagine wastewater flooding your prep area during the rush. Grease and FOG doesn’t just stay still; it cools and solidifies inside pipes.

This causes major clogs that can hit your entire plumbing system. A key rule is to ensure waste never exceeds one quarter of your interceptor’s working volume. Crossing that threshold drastically increases the risk of a major sewer backup.

That kind of event can force immediate closure, creates lost revenue, and demands costly emergency repairs. It’s a disaster scenario that brings operations to a halt.

Scheduled Grease Trap Pumping

Staying consistent is essential to stopping problems. The frequency for this core maintenance typically ranges from roughly every one to three months.

We determine the best schedule based on your kitchen’s specific output and local requirements. Our team creates a customized plan to ensure your unit never reaches a critical level.

Proactive care is the most effective way to stop emergencies before they start.

Detailed Service Report And Maintenance Advice

After every visit, you receive a full service manifest. This document details the date, volume removed, and the condition of your system.

It serves as your official proof of compliance for inspectors. The report also helps you plan future upkeep by noting any early warning signs.

Our technicians are happy to share easy best practices. They might advise on using sink strainers or proper scraping techniques to reduce FOG going into drains.
